VA Prescription Data Accountability Act 2017

115th Congress · Approved Nov 21, 2017 · 131 Stat. 1276

An Act

To amend title 38, United States Code, to clarify the authority of the Secretary of Veterans Affairs to disclose certain patient information to State controlled substance monitoring programs, and for other purposes.

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representa­tives of the United States of America in Congress assembled,

SECTION 1. Short Title.

This Act may be cited as the “VA Prescription Data Accountability Act 2017”.
